Output 21ac0b8785df7067f62cf8a23e7c69ab2a87bcddbb929e0b8c6fcb587534dff7:4

value
1336615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df0b7cd6fdf525fde29b7e06d7de276364ef2c1 OP_EQUAL
address
3DAvkuCwAc6SCexbWc2DHmHnxaRxxKEQPh
transaction
21ac0b8785df7067f62cf8a23e7c69ab2a87bcddbb929e0b8c6fcb587534dff7
spent
true